Fleet Tracks information is collected by a Windows Service that runs in the background. This service connects to Truckers Helper servers every 10 minutes to check for updates. This service is normally started automatically when you start The Truckers Helper. If for any reason this service is not running you database will not be getting the regular updates and you'll need to start the service to start manually. Once the service is restarted it will automatically collect any updates that have not already been received.
To Restart Fleet Tracks Service:
Open the Routing screen as detailed in About Routing.
Click FLEET TRACKS/RESTART SERVICE on the menu bar.
The program will restart the service. If the service is already running you will be informed of this.
You can tell whether the service is running or not on the Dispatch Screen. If the LOCATION & DATE/TIME fields are GREEN the service is running, if they are RED the service is not running and should be restarted.
